Rapid growth nanoparticle low-e coating

Markku Rajala, Joe Pimenoff, Anssi Hovinen, Tommi Vainio
Beneq Oy

Current pyrolytic coating processes are limited by the growth rate and the raw material conversion efficiency is typically poor. The authors present a novel process where both the growth rate and the conversion efficiency can be significantly increased. In addition to low-e coatings the process can be utilized for other glass coatings and for modifying the glass surface and improving the surface properties of glass.
